The Queuewright autoscaler watches depth on the ingest queues and adds workers when the backlog crosses 5,000 messages for more than two minutes. If it's flapping, don't panic — usually someone shipped a slow consumer. First, check the scaler dashboard and confirm the depth metric isn't stale. If you need to poke the scaler API directly (pause, force-scale, or dump its decision log), hit the Queuewright admin endpoint from the ops bastion. Authenticate those calls with the internal key shown below.

service key, yadug-bajog: zpat3_pou

## Service accounts: calendar sync

Welcome aboard! Quick context: the Plumline calendar sync job runs under a dedicated service account, not your personal creds — please don't swap those in, it causes the dreaded double-booking conflict we hit last spring when two syncers fought over the same event revision. The service account has read/write on Hollyhock Calendar only, nothing else. If sync conflicts pile up, check that only one worker holds the account. For local testing against the staging sync API, use the service-account key pasted below.

service key, fawip-bajef: kto11_Qt5wZK9vdNC

**Changelog — Pulsewren telemetry defaults**

Heads up for the sync: as of this week, Pulsewren compresses telemetry payloads by default instead of shipping raw JSON. We flipped this after the Karnow cluster kept blowing past its egress budget — compression cut payload size roughly 70% in staging with negligible CPU cost. If your consumer can't handle gzip frames yet, pin the old behavior per-stream, but plan to migrate by next month. The current defaults we're shipping are as follows.

deployment values, taduf-fawig:
WENAEL_HOST=wenael.zemvarlabs.internal
WENAEL_PORT=8443

Ticket: Renderfall transcode farm drops 4K jobs silently when the Oakmere node pool scales past 40 workers. No error surfaced; jobs vanish from the queue after claim. Repro is consistent above 38 concurrent claims. Suspect lease-renewal race in the scheduler. Workaround: cap pool at 36. Needs owner before Friday sync. Failing farm build is identified by the token below.

trace token, tawep-fahif: htk3_b58